I like donnas but I have found out over the years that the "Better Boys" produce the most weigt and flavor. I did 60 plants last year and jarred 106 quarts of maters plus what I ate and gave away. I am thinking about turning up my 2nd garden and doing 100 plants this year. It just takes patience and good soil. Also a good watering system. I ind peace and serenity in m garden. You dont need a totally beatiful garden to produce. One can over think a garden. One will be amazed at what a half arse garden can produce.
